Mission

TO BUILD A SENSE OF STATEWIDE BUSINESS COMMUNITY. AS THE STATE CHAMBER OF COMMERCE, THE ORGANIZATION SERVES AS A MEANINGFUL VOICE ON ISSUES AND INITIATIVES FOCUSING ON THE STATE'S FUTURE IN EDUCATION, WORKFORCE, BUSINESS CLIMATE AND IMAGE.
